Android SDK安装错误

4

安装Android SDK。使用最新版本的Eclipse Juno。在安装过程中遇到了一些小问题,但成功解决了。但现在我遇到了一个无法解决的问题。我已经下载了Eclipse ADT插件。当我重启Eclipse时,它给了我这个错误消息:“此版本的ADT需要Android SDK工具的版本为20.0.0或以上。当前版本为16.0.0。请更新您的SDK工具到最新版本。”错误对话框给我提供了一个按钮来打开SDK管理器,我点击了它。它打开了SDK管理器,并找到了我需要的新软件包。但当我尝试安装它们时,又出现了另一个错误。日志显示:

"Failed to rename directory C:\Program Files (x86)\Android\android-sdk\platform-tools to 
C:\Program Files (x86)\Android\android-sdk\temp\PlatformToolPackage.old01."

然后弹出对话框告诉我它无法重命名文件夹,让我尝试使其工作。但这永远无法实现,我不得不一路取消所有操作回到Eclipse(仍然生气我没有最新的东西)。

我已经尝试过重新启动等方法,但都没有帮助。我尝试以管理员身份运行SDK Manager,但当我这样做时,它认为自己已经拥有所有最新的东西(奇怪),并且不想下载任何东西。

只是提醒一下,我的Android SDK工具版本是Rev.16(它需要20), Android SDK平台工具版本是Rev.10(它需要12)。

感谢任何帮助!


就我个人而言,我不建议将SDK放在Program Files中,因为SDK和NDK中有很多东西与路径中的空格不太兼容,这可能是您当前问题的根源,最好的方法是在某个地方安装Linux并以此方式工作(相信我,这对于Android开发非常值得)。 - JRaymond
1个回答

0

你是否以管理员身份启动了Eclipse?如果没有,请尝试一下,有时候只有管理员才能安装更新。如果我要更新SDK,我会先在没有打开Eclipse的情况下启动SDK-Manager来安装更新。完成后,我再在Eclipse中进行相同的操作。请务必以管理员身份运行。


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接